What Makes a Durable Metal Hand Sanitizer Stand Worth Buying

Material Quality Is Everything

Not all metal is equal. Stainless steel stands up to rust, dents, and daily wear. Powder-coated finishes help prevent scratches, especially in high-traffic areas. A weak frame might survive a few weeks. A strong one lasts for years.

Stability and Base Design

A good stand should not wobble when pressed. Particularly, foot-operated models require a strong base. When it changes, it loses confidence among users.

Look for:

  • Wide base support
  • Anti-slip padding
  • Equal distribution of weight.

Touch-Free Mechanism

Foot pedal systems reduce hand contact completely. That alone cuts down contamination risk.

How to Choose the Right Stand (Quick Checklist)

With a basic checklist, it becomes easy to make buying decisions. Concentrate on what will be used on a daily basis.

  • Material: Coated metal or stainless steel.
  • Operation: Touch-free or foot pedal system.
  • Stability: Stable, no wobbling.
  • Portability: Lightweight, should there be a need to move.
  • Maintenance: Cleaning, refilling and repairing is easy.

Missing one of them can always bring regrets in the future.

Common Mistakes Buyers Make

The majority of buyers tend to purchase at the lowest price. That usually backfires.

Mistakes to Avoid

  • Choosing plastic over metal for high-traffic areas
  • Ignoring base stability
  • Buying battery-operated units without backup
  • Overlooking refill compatibility
  • Not considering placement and visibility

3. Are foot-operated sanitizer stands better than automatic ones?

Foot-operated stands are often more reliable. They do not depend on batteries and reduce hand contact completely, making them practical for high-traffic areas.
